Bio Ethanol Fireplaces

Ethanol fireplaces are great to add a warm feel to any space without the expense of structural work or gas supply. They are the most secure fireplace type that is available.

If you use only bio-ethanol fuel specifically designed for your fire, and follow all safety instructions then your fireplace will be operating safely.

Ease of installation

Ethanol fires are a quick and easy solution for homeowners who want to make their living spaces more attractive or create a focal point for their home decor. You don't need a chimney and they don’t emit dangerous smoke. Smoke won't linger on your walls or ceilings.

Installation is easy and doesn't require any specialist help. All you have to do is make sure that the wall or ceiling is sturdy enough and follow the instructions for the specific model.

If you opt for a wall-mounted ethanol fireplace they are usually equipped with the necessary hardware to allow them to be either hung like a flat-screen TV, or placed in the wall. You'll have to locate the studs and install the brackets and extensions however, it should not take more than an hour for an expert to do this.

You also have a choice of automatic or manual bio ethanol burners. The automatic burner keeps the fuel away from the flames so that it can burn longer without the risk of overheating or running out. A manual burner works in the same way as a traditional fireplace, but you'll need to use matches or lighters to light the flames.

It's important to remember when choosing a bio-ethanol burner, the burner should be covered with non-combustible materials. This will ensure that nothing gets in contact with the burning fuel. If you don't cover your burner, it could cause the fire to overheat. This could damage the fireplace.

The Ethanol fireplace is a wonderful choice for those who want a dramatic feature to add to their home but do not have the time or budget to build a gas or wood fireplace. They are perfect for renovations and new homes where chimney breasts have been removed. They don't create soot or ash, which means there's no maintenance issues.

Designs and styles

Bio ethanol fireplaces come in various styles and designs. Some are more traditional in their wood-burning fireplace look, while others are designed to look sleek and modern. Regardless of the style, each type offers the same benefits: authentic flame ambience without fumes or harmful gases.

Ethanol fireplaces can be wall mounted. Freestanding models can be moved around a room to suit your needs. Wall-mounted models, on the other hand, are fixed to the wall and require special mounting equipment. They must also comply with certain distances between the flammable material and the unit.

The fire itself originates from the burner pan, which is located on the bottom of the fireplace. Fuel is poured into the pan and the fire is lit by a long lighter. The process takes around 15 minutes to get the fire up to its full flame potential. Once the fire is lit you can relax and enjoy the warm ambience of your home.

Some ethanol fire places offer temperature settings that can be adjusted. This allows you to adjust the amount of heat that your fireplace generates.

Another benefit of ethanol fires is that there is no need for an chimney or flue. This makes them an excellent option for new homes or older homes that do not have traditional chimney breasts or fireplaces. Furthermore, a bio-ethanol fire place does not generate gas or ash that could pose a risk for those suffering from respiratory issues.

Bio ethanol fireplaces are also easy to install inside your home. The time required to install will depend on the model you choose. However, most models can be installed quickly. You can opt for a portable freestanding fireplace which can be taken with you if ever you relocate. This is a great choice for living arrangements that are temporary. The ease of installation is a crucial factor for many people, and it is something to consider when shopping for a new fireplace.

No flue

The main benefit that bioethanol fires have over traditional gas or wood fires is that they don't require a flue in order to function. In the end, there's no chance of chimney fires which could be caused by the build-up of tar, or an obstruction in the flue.

A bio ethanol fireplace also doesn't create a lot of particulates that can damage the air quality, which is great news for those who suffer from asthma or allergies. The fire doesn't produce smoke, so it does not create a unpleasant odor in the room.

As opposed to a wood-burning fireplace bioethanol fires don't lose much heat through the chimney, so it can produce an incredible amount of heat for its size. This means you can keep your furniture in close proximity to the flame without having to worry about catching a flame which could be dangerous for your valuables.

If you decide to go with a freestanding bioethanol fireplace there are different designs you can choose from. You can pick a wall-mounted model for an elegant, modern appearance or a recessed unit that blends into the style of your home.

A burner that is either manual or automated is a second thing to think about. A manual burner requires you to ignite the fuel directly from the reservoir while an automatic burner will automatically light the fire when the tank is empty.

It is important that you allow the flames to fully burn out and wait until the burner cools down before refilling. If you don't, the ethanol could evaporate and you'll have to start again.

The majority of manufacturers advise that you leave at least 45 minutes between refilling your fire so that you have enough time to safely put out the flames and ensure all flammable materials are away from the flame. To avoid accidents, store any spare ethanol fuel away from pets and children.

Easy maintenance

The bioethanol fuel is added to the burner and then ignited. The heat and flame created by the burning fuel can be controlled by an adjustable slider. (Not all designs have this feature). By altering the amount of oxygen is fed to the fire you can alter the speed at which the fuel burns and also the intensity of the flame.

As the fuel burns it releases tiny amounts of soot, which is easily cleaned by wiping down the fireplace with a soft cloth. The only other maintenance is to ensure that the burner is full of the correct fuel and to ensure it is Fireplace UK kept away from any items or materials that are flammable.

Another benefit of bioethanol fires is that you can set them virtually anywhere without having to worry about chimneys or building regulations. This gives you a huge amount of flexibility when it comes to the design of your home and where you can enjoy the warmth and beauty of your new fireplace. You can also opt to have a free-standing fireplace that you can move from room to room.

Wall-mounted bio ethanol fireplaces are able to be installed on your wall with ease, and some models can be rotated by 180 degrees, allowing you to move the flame and heat into the desired area of your room. You can also mount remote controls on some designs to take full control from the comfortable sofa.

Many wall-mounted bioethanol fireplaces come with brackets that enable them to be fixed to a flat ceiling or sloping one. Installing the fireplace anywhere you'd like is possible however, you can still make use of the remote control to turn it off and adjust the flame's height as well as adjust the temperature.

When you're not using the ethanol fireplace, be sure to turn it off and keep it away from any flammable items or materials. Do not pour any fuel into the burner until the burner has reached the temperature of room temperature. Be cautious when handling it as it is extremely hot.
